WebHurricane Laura came ashore near Cameron, Louisiana, early in the morning of August 27, 2024, as a Category 4 storm with 150 mph winds and a low pressure of 937mb. It built a 10-foot storm surge in Cameron and surrounding areas. Gulf Coast areas that were struck by Laura were affected again six weeks later by Hurricane Delta.
